The Lord Mayor and his aldermen have been down since the morning, striving to do what they can; but, so far as report says, the flames are yet unchecked.

It seems impossible that they should ever reach even to us here; but I am somewhat full of fear.

What would befall my poor young wife if the fire were to threaten this house ?" Dinah looked grave and anxious.

Lady Desborough's condition was critical, and she could only be moved at considerable risk.

But it seemed impossible that the fire could travel all this distance.
Only the troubled look on the husband's face would have convinced her that such a thing could be contemplated for a moment even by the faintest-hearted.
"You would not have us move her now, ere the danger approaches ?" asked the husband anxiously.
"No, my lord.
